Furniture restoration:
  I was commissioned to restore a Baroque table that had been left outside in the rain and bad weather for over 40 years. In truth, the table was nothing more than firewood, but due to the table being a family antique, this particular client was keen to have it restored. As you can see from the images, the deteriation was such that I had to reproduce many of the pieces and designs without this being visible to the human eye.

Restoration and painting of an antique bedroom:

With this painting technology different colours were varnished about one another and afterwards polished with steel wool. This generates an old appearance of the pieces of furniture. The colours were tuned to the wall colour
